DE52 FXD is a 2002 Toyota Landcruiser in Black with a 2,982cc diesel engine. This vehicle has been through 30 MOT tests with a personal pass rate of 70%.
Across all 2002 Toyota Landcruiser models, the average MOT pass rate is 74.8% with a typical mileage of 118,219 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Toyota Landcruiser fails its MOT is brake pipe excessively corroded, accounting for 5,381 recorded failures. If you're considering buying DE52 FXD, it's worth having these areas checked by a mechanic before committing.
The Toyota Landcruiser typically stays on UK roads for around 37 years. At 24 years old, this Toyota Landcruiser is well into its expected lifespan but still has years ahead.
